The Evolution of Home Design

The trajectory of home decor reflects broader societal shifts . Initially, dwellings were primarily functional , focused on safety from the elements and performing basic needs. As civilizations progressed , so did the concept of the home. The Medieval period saw the appearance of more elaborate buildings , often displaying prominence through intricate detailing . The Renaissance ushered in an era of balance and established influences, impacting interior layouts and accessories. The Victorian era embraced complexity, with heavily decorated spaces. The 20th century brought modern movements, like Art Deco and Mid-Century Modern, stressing simplicity and practicality . Today, we see a combination of these historical styles, with a growing attention on sustainability, advancement, and personalized style .

Key developments have included:

  • The move from communal living to private residences.
  • The introduction of new substances like concrete and steel.
  • The influence of globalization on style trends.
  • The growing importance of resource efficiency.
